His funeral will be preceded by a ceremony at city hall before a procession in cars will visit some of places in Rome dearest to his heart, including the Brancaccio Theatre on Via Merulana and the Globe in Villa Borghese. There will be a maximum of 60 guests and the ceremony will be screened live on RAI 3 at 13.00. Proietti's funeral will take place at the Chiesa degli Artisti in Piazza del Popolo, without the public, to avoid any crowds due to the covid-19 protocols.

Rome is to rename the city's Globe Theatre after Gigi Proietti, the much-loved actor, director and comedian who died yesterday on his 80th birthday. Proietti had a long and fruitful association with Rome's Globe Theatre.
